I like your idea for the two of them being on the roofs of the elevators, then thinking about it further, I realized both elevators would have needed to arrive at and leave the ground floor at the same time for it to work. Then once all the goons entered them and they started rising, unless the escape door (sometimes only 2' X 3') was already open, Nikki and Wrench would've had to open them before they could shoot. Too risky. Also, it's too easy for the goons to just point their ARs straight up and fire wildly once the shooting started. Also, Nikki had to remain separate from the upstairs kill so she could take out the two goons that stayed behind with the vehicles. And yes, the roof of that elevator looked to be completely gone, not a 2' X 3' (or larger) door, and I think that's a bit of a flaw. I don't know how Varga could've opened the entire roof unless he had a very speedy electric screwdriver with lots of bits to choose from.
